Romenesko Memos
“Please be polite,” wrote Susan Spring, the News & Observer’s director of newsroom operations. “If you are working elections, you may have up to TWO slices” of pizza. A few hours later, executive editor John Drescher vetoed the limit, but added that “if Susan Spring chases you with a knife in her hand, you are on your own.”
